A hanging basket is a suspended container used for growing decorative plants. Typically they are hung from buildings, where garden space is at a premium, and from street furniture for environmental enhancement. They may also be suspended from free standing frames sometimes called hanging basket trees. One type of hanging basket is the inverted planter where plants are grown in an upside down pot and are watered from the top.

Support-free construction method for continuous rigid frame of V-shaped pier

The invention discloses a V-shaped pier continuous rigid frame non-support construction method, belongs to the technical field of bridge construction, and solves the problem of large occupied space of existing V-shaped pier construction. No floor supporting frame is arranged under the bridge, roads and channels under the bridge are not occupied, and vehicle passing or ship navigation under the bridge is not affected by bridge construction; according to the method, a constructed structure serves as a beam body pouring supporting platform, no support is arranged under a bridge, and therefore the temporary pile foundation engineering amount and the support engineering amount are reduced, the manufacturing cost is greatly saved, and economic benefits are remarkable; compared with an existing hanging basket construction method, the hanging basket construction method does not need a supporting frame, the beam body is poured through a hanging basket cantilever, only the bailey beam is needed, and a hanging basket is not needed. Compared with a bailey beam, the hanging basket is customized, the bailey beam only needs to be leased and assembled, the cost is low, meanwhile, the construction of the hanging basket has certain technical difficulty, and the construction of the bailey beam is relatively low in technical difficulty, small in risk and high in safety.
